在互联网时代,表单是网站与用户交互的重要工具。无论是收集用户信息、提交订单还是进行问卷调查,表单都扮演着不可或缺的角色。为了帮助新手快速入门并提升表单设计效率,本文将为您盘点5款热门的Web表单开发框架。
1. Bootstrap Form Builder
Bootstrap Form Builder是一款基于Bootstrap框架的表单生成工具。它允许开发者通过拖拽的方式快速构建出美观、响应式的表单。以下是该框架的几个亮点:
- 可视化界面:通过拖拽组件,无需编写代码即可完成表单设计。
- 丰富的组件:支持文本框、单选框、复选框、下拉菜单等多种表单组件。
- 响应式设计:自动适配不同设备屏幕,确保表单在不同设备上均能正常显示。
2. jQuery Form Plugin
jQuery Form Plugin是一款基于jQuery的表单处理插件。它可以帮助开发者简化表单验证、提交等操作。以下是该插件的主要特点:
- 简洁的API:易于使用,方便开发者快速上手。
- 表单验证:支持多种验证方式,如必填、邮箱格式、手机号码等。
- AJAX提交:支持异步表单提交,提升用户体验。
3. Formik
Formik是一款React表单库,旨在简化React表单的开发过程。它提供了丰富的功能和灵活的配置,以下是Formik的几个优势:
- 类型友好:使用TypeScript编写,提供类型安全的表单处理。
- 表单状态管理:自动处理表单状态,无需手动维护。
- 表单验证:内置验证功能,支持自定义验证规则。
4. Final Form
Final Form是一款基于Formik的表单库,它扩展了Formik的功能,并提供了一些额外的特性。以下是Final Form的亮点:
- 集成状态管理:与Redux等状态管理库无缝集成。
- 自定义组件:支持自定义组件,满足不同需求。
- 表单验证:支持自定义验证规则,灵活性强。
5. React Hook Form
React Hook Form是一款基于React Hook的表单库,它旨在简化React表单的开发。以下是React Hook Form的几个特点:
- 无依赖:不依赖于其他库,安装简单。
- 类型友好:使用TypeScript编写,提供类型安全。
- 可定制性:支持自定义组件和验证规则。
总结:
以上5款Web表单开发框架各有特色,适合不同场景下的表单开发需求。作为一名新手,可以根据自己的实际情况选择合适的框架,提升表单设计效率。希望本文对您有所帮助!
